Question
light appears to travel in astright line, because
Options
A.its wavelength is very small
B.its velocity is large
C.it is not absorbed by surroundings
D.it is reflected by surroundings
Solution
Light appears to travel in a straight line because different (or deviation from the path)is least in light. Diffraction is least because of small wave length of light cause the light to t ravel almost in straight line.
